(我英语不好)
我们正在开发一个在线考试工具。用户必须回答几个问题,并有 X 分钟的时间来回答。X 分钟后,表格必须自动发送,保存在此之前回答的问题。
我认为在 Javascript 中进行倒计时是可以的,但是具有使用 Firefox 控制台知识的学生可以避免它,并且有无限的时间。
我想在考试开始的那一刻保存一个饼干。如果在此之后提交了表单(我会在服务器端检查它),我可以将其设为无效,但我会丢失任何有效答案(我的意思是,在 X 分钟之前写的答案)。
你怎么看?这有什么好的做法吗?
(我英语不好)
我们正在开发一个在线考试工具。用户必须回答几个问题,并有 X 分钟的时间来回答。X 分钟后,表格必须自动发送,保存在此之前回答的问题。
我认为在 Javascript 中进行倒计时是可以的,但是具有使用 Firefox 控制台知识的学生可以避免它,并且有无限的时间。
我想在考试开始的那一刻保存一个饼干。如果在此之后提交了表单(我会在服务器端检查它),我可以将其设为无效,但我会丢失任何有效答案(我的意思是,在 X 分钟之前写的答案)。
你怎么看?这有什么好的做法吗?